Output 21c8d28eb5a7b34d856b5aae777f2e042fd14c927dd41a8d371af45865720901:0

value
58650480
script pubkey
OP_0 OP_PUSHBYTES_20 695db730a7b11b7cd8be4a46301d13b14fe0ca14
address
bc1qd9wmwv98kydhek97ffrrq8gnk987pjs5w502d4
transaction
21c8d28eb5a7b34d856b5aae777f2e042fd14c927dd41a8d371af45865720901
spent
true